Teaser Trailers: Not Just for Movies

I've been talking a lot about animations and videos done to promote videogames recently, and today Kotaku covered a new "teaser" out for an unknown, upcoming FPS.



The name of the game and gameplay will premiere during the VGAs on December 12 at 8pmET/PT on Spike. A Halo: Reach trailer is also scheduled for the broadcast.

Teasers are an excellent way to build viral buzz, if done well. Cloverfield is a great example of this for the movie industry. Mystery can become allure very quickly, and 2K Games (the folks behind BioShock, Civ IV, The Elder Scrolls: Oblivion, and many other blockbuster titles) is hardly a small-time player.

And when you've got that kind of industry clout, why not exercise it in a less conventional way?
